Full Specifications
- Network Technology: GSM / HSPA / LTE
- Launch Announced: 2020, September 07 Status: Available. Released 2020, September 07
- Body
Dimensions: 170 x 78.1 x 9.7 mm (6.69 x 3.07 x 0.38 in)
Weight: 223 g (7.87 oz)
Build: Glass front, plastic back, plastic frame
SIM: Nano-SIM
Nano-SIM + Nano-SIM
- Display Type: IPS LCD, HDR10 Size: 6.81 inches, 112.0 cm2 (~84.3% screen-to-body ratio) Resolution: 1080 x 2400 pixels, 20:9 ratio (~386 ppi density)
- Platform OS: Android 10, upgradable to Android 11 Chipset: Qualcomm SDM730 Snapdragon 730G (8 nm) CPU: Octa-core (2x2.2 GHz Kryo 470 Gold & 6x1.8 GHz Kryo 470 Silver) GPU: Adreno 618
- Memory Card slot - microSDXC (uses shared SIM slot) Internal: 64GB 4GB RAM, 128GB 4GB RAM, 128GB 6GB RAM
- Main Camera
Quad: 64 MP, f/1.8, 26mm (wide), 1/1.73", 0.8µm, PDAF
8 MP, f/2.2, 118˚ (ultrawide), 1/4.0", 1.12µm
2 MP, f/2.2, (macro)
2 MP, f/2.2, (depth) Features: LED flash, HDR, panorama Video: 4K@30fps, 1080p@30/60/120fps, gyro-EIS
- Selfie camera Single: 16 MP, f/2.0, 29mm (standard) Features: HDR Video: 1080p@30fps
- Sound Loudspeaker : Yes 3.5mm jack : Yes
- Comms WLAN: Wi-Fi 802.11 a/b/g/n/ac, dual-band, Wi-Fi Direct Bluetooth: 5.0, A2DP, LE Positioning: GPS, GLONASS, GALILEO NFC: Yes Radio: FM radio USB: USB Type-C 2.0
- Features Sensors: Fingerprint (side-mounted), accelerometer, gyro, proximity
- Battery Type: Li-Po 5000 mAh Charging: 30W wired
- Misc Colors: Rose Gold, Indigo Blue Models: XT2087-1 Price: About 300 EUR
